Remembering the Fritz 2010
For the 14th consecutive year, members of the Stu Rockafellow Amateur Radio Society will be traveling to Whitefish Point, Mi. and Paradise, Mi. to do a ham radio Special event Remembering the Edmund Fitzgerald.
The Fitzgerald went down with her crew of 29 on November 10th 1975 in Lake Superior approximately 17 miles from Whitefish Point, Mi. This marks the 35th year of that tragedy.
The call sign used at Whitefish Point will be N8F and the call sign used at Paradise, Mi. ( 11 miles South of Whitefish Point) will be K8F. The Whitefish Point Lighthouse # is USA 887 We expect to be operational Friday Nov. 5th Thur Sun. Nov. 7th. with up to 4 stations.Target frequencies are 3860, 7240, 14260, 18160*, 21360, and 28360* (kHz SSB) (* secondary) CW operation is not planned only a certificate will be available.

Also, teaming up with us this year are:
(1)The Livonia Amateur Radio Club from Livonia, Mi. using the call sign W8F and operating from the Dossin Great Lakes Museum, Sat. Nov. 6th , located on Belle Isle in the Detroit River.
(2)The Stillwater Amateur Radio Association from Stillwater, Mn. using their club call sign, W0JH operating 3 stations from The Split Rock Lighthouse State Park at the West end of Lake Superior ( Lighthouse # USA 783 )
